
Here’s a comparison of tax credits for residential vs. commercial energy storage systems based on current policies:
Residential Systems
Credit Type: Residential Clean Energy Credit (IRS Section 25D)
- Rate: 30% (2022–2032), decreasing to 26% (2033) and 22% (2034)
- Eligibility:
- Installations: New systems in principal residences or second homes (rentals excluded)
- Storage Requirements: Minimum 3 kWh capacity
- Claim Process: IRS Form 5695
- Key Limit: Nonrefundable credit with unlimited annual claims (except fuel cells)
